VSIGX vs. VTIAX
Compare and contrast key facts about Vanguard Intermediate-Term Treasury Index Fund Admiral Shares (VSIGX) and Vanguard Total International Stock Index Fund Admiral Shares (VTIAX).
VSIGX is managed by Vanguard. It was launched on Aug 4, 2010. VTIAX is managed by Vanguard. It was launched on Nov 29, 2010.

VSIGX vs. VTIAX -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
VSIGX Vanguard Intermediate-Term Treasury Index Fund Admiral Shares | -0.24% | 7.36% | 1.65% | 4.39% | -10.69% | -2.60% | 7.65% | 6.26% | 1.35% | 1.58% |
VTIAX Vanguard Total International Stock Index Fund Admiral Shares | -1.02% | 32.18% | 5.34% | 15.28% | -16.02% | 8.59% | 11.27% | 21.52% | -14.46% | 27.54% |
Returns By Period
In the year-to-date period, VSIGX achieves a -0.24% return, which is significantly higher than VTIAX's -1.02% return. Over the past 10 years, VSIGX has underperformed VTIAX with an annualized return of 1.31%, while VTIAX has yielded a comparatively higher 8.51% annualized return.

VSIGX vs. VTIAX - Expense Ratio Comparison
VSIGX has a 0.07% expense ratio, which is lower than VTIAX's 0.11% expense ratio. Despite the difference,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

Correlation
The correlation between VSIGX and VTIAX is -0.15. This indicates that the assets' prices tend to move in opposite directions. Negative correlation can be particularly beneficial for diversification and risk management, as one asset may offset the losses of the other during market fluctuations.
Dividends
VSIGX vs. VTIAX - Dividend Comparison
VSIGX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 3.46%, more than VTIAX's 3.03% yield.
| TTM |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| 2016 | 2015 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
VSIGX Vanguard Intermediate-Term Treasury Index Fund Admiral Shares | 3.46% | 3.76% | 3.95% | 2.70% | 1.71% | 1.66% | 2.21% | 2.21% | 2.05% | 1.67% | 1.56% | 1.70% |
VTIAX Vanguard Total International Stock Index Fund Admiral Shares | 3.03% | 3.15% | 3.33% | 3.22% | 3.04% | 3.05% | 2.10% | 3.04% | 3.16% | 2.73% | 2.93% | 2.84% |
Drawdowns
VSIGX vs. VTIAX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um VSIGX drawdown since its inception was -16.15%, smaller than the maximum VTIAX drawdown of -35.83%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for VSIGX and VTIAX.

Volatility
VSIGX vs. VTIAX -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for Vanguard Intermediate-Term Treasury Index Fund Admiral Shares (VSIGX) is 1.38%, while Vanguard Total International Stock Index Fund Admiral Shares (VTIAX) has a volatility of 6.80%. This indicates that VSIGX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than VTIAX based on this measure.
